Principal Antenna Design Engineer I

CesiumAstro is a pioneering company in the development of innovative communication systems for satellites and airborne platforms. They are seeking a Principal Antenna Design Engineer I who will be responsible for the design, simulation, and testing of high-frequency antennas, contributing to the development of leading-edge RF hardware for aerospace systems.

Responsibilities

Responsible for antenna designs from initial concept through requirements definition, topology selection, detailed design, analysis, optimization, manufacturing, testing, qualification, and in-orbit support of Cesium's products
Include many aspects of phased array communication systems, including RF front-ends, beamformers, power dividers, and phased array antennas
Present engineering design review materials to our customers and executive team, as well as participate in proposal-writing efforts

Required

Bachelor of Science (BS) degree or higher in Electrical Engineering or Physics from an accredited university or institution
Minimum of 9 years of industry or university research experience in antenna design, analysis, optimization, fabrication, and test
Phased array design and development
Expert-level proficiency in 3D electromagnetic simulation tools such as CST or HFSS
Strong experience with EDA tools such as Altium
Hands-on experience with lab instruments such as vector network analyzers, spectrum analyzers, signal generators, and oscilloscopes
Excellent written and verbal communication skills

Preferred

Antenna design in frequency bands above 20 GHz
Aerospace electronics design, development, and qualification
EMI/EMC design and mitigation techniques
